2022 Honda Odyssey Recall: Second-row outboard seats may have deformed seat rail locking mechanisms…

NHTSA campaign 21V432000 · Seats · filed Jun 7, 2021 · verified Jul 30, 2026

Units reported
649
Manufacturer
Honda (American Honda Motor Co.)
Risk
Crash / injury
Owner letters
Mailing began Aug 4, 2021

The defect

Honda (American Honda Motor Co.) is recalling certain 2022 Odyssey vehicles. The second-row outboard seats may have deformed seat rail locking mechanisms, which could prevent the seat rails from locking into place.

The risk

A seat that is not locked into place can move unexpectedly, increasing the risk of injury.

The fix — what to do

Dealers will replace both second-row outboard seat frames, free of charge. Owner notification letters were mailed August 4, 2021. Owners may contact Honda customer service at 1-888-234-2138. Honda's number for this recall is YBE.

Owners may also contact the National Highway Traffic Safety Administration Vehicle Safety Hotline at 1-888-327-4236 (TTY 1-800-424-9153), or go to www.nhtsa.gov.
